Description
An Authentication Bypass Using an Alternate Path or Channel vulnerability in Juniper Networks Session Smart Router or conductor running with a redundant peer allows a network based attacker to bypass authentication and take full control of the device. Only routers or conductors that are running in high-availability redundant configurations are affected by this vulnerability. No other Juniper Networks products or platforms are affected by this issue. This issue affects: Session Smart Router:  * All versions before 5.6.15,  * from 6.0 before 6.1.9-lts,  * from 6.2 before 6.2.5-sts. Session Smart Conductor:  * All versions before 5.6.15,  * from 6.0 before 6.1.9-lts,  * from 6.2 before 6.2.5-sts.  WAN Assurance Router:  * 6.0 versions before 6.1.9-lts,  * 6.2 versions before 6.2.5-sts.
